Questions marquées «python»

Python est un langage de programmation polyvalent à paradigmes multiples et à typage dynamique. Il est conçu pour être rapide à apprendre, comprendre et utiliser, et appliquer une syntaxe propre et uniforme. Veuillez noter que Python 2 n'est officiellement plus pris en charge depuis le 01-01-2020. Néanmoins, pour les questions Python spécifiques à la version, ajoutez la balise [python-2.7] ou [python-3.x]. Lorsque vous utilisez une variante ou une bibliothèque Python (par exemple Jython, PyPy, Pandas, Numpy), veuillez l'inclure dans les balises.

5
Que fait le code source du module «this»?
Si vous ouvrez un interpréteur Python et tapez "import this", comme vous le savez, il imprime: Le Zen de Python, par Tim Peters Beau est mieux que laid. L'explicite vaut mieux que l'implicite. Le simple vaut mieux que le complexe. Complexe vaut mieux que compliqué. Plat est mieux que niché. …
193 python 





13
Définir la classe css dans django Forms
Supposons que j'ai un formulaire class SampleClass(forms.Form): name = forms.CharField(max_length=30) age = forms.IntegerField() django_hacker = forms.BooleanField(required=False) Existe-t-il un moyen pour moi de définir des classes css sur chaque champ de sorte que je puisse ensuite utiliser jQuery en fonction de la classe dans ma page rendue? J'espérais ne pas avoir …

6
Enregistrer le classificateur sur le disque dans scikit-learn
Comment enregistrer un classificateur Naive Bayes entraîné sur le disque et l'utiliser pour prédire les données? J'ai l'exemple de programme suivant du site Web scikit-learn: from sklearn import datasets iris = datasets.load_iris() from sklearn.naive_bayes import GaussianNB gnb = GaussianNB() y_pred = gnb.fit(iris.data, iris.target).predict(iris.data) print "Number of mislabeled points : %d" …

5
Le meilleur moyen d'enregistrer un modèle entraîné dans PyTorch?
Je cherchais des moyens alternatifs pour enregistrer un modèle entraîné dans PyTorch. Jusqu'à présent, j'ai trouvé deux alternatives. torch.save () pour enregistrer un modèle et torch.load () pour charger un modèle. model.state_dict () pour enregistrer un modèle entraîné et model.load_state_dict () pour charger le modèle enregistré. Je suis tombé sur …

13
Obtenez le hachage MD5 de gros fichiers en Python
J'ai utilisé hashlib (qui remplace md5 dans Python 2.6 / 3.0) et cela fonctionnait bien si j'ouvrais un fichier et mettais son contenu en hashlib.md5()fonction. Le problème est que les très gros fichiers peuvent dépasser la taille de la RAM. Comment obtenir le hachage MD5 d'un fichier sans charger le …
192 python  md5  hashlib 

5
NameError: le nom 'réduire' n'est pas défini en Python
J'utilise Python 3.2. J'ai essayé ceci: xor = lambda x,y: (x+y)%2 l = reduce(xor, [1,2,3,4]) Et j'ai l'erreur suivante: l = reduce(xor, [1,2,3,4]) NameError: name 'reduce' is not defined J'ai essayé l'impression reducedans la console interactive - j'ai obtenu cette erreur: NameError: name 'reduce' is not defined Est-ce reducevraiment supprimé …

12
Comment joindre deux générateurs en Python?
Je souhaite modifier le code suivant for directory, dirs, files in os.walk(directory_1): do_something() for directory, dirs, files in os.walk(directory_2): do_something() à ce code: for directory, dirs, files in os.walk(directory_1) + os.walk(directory_2): do_something() J'obtiens l'erreur: type (s) d'opérande non pris en charge pour +: 'générateur' et 'générateur' Comment joindre deux générateurs …
192 python  generator 

5
Puis-je définir max_retries pour requests.request?
Le module de requêtes Python est simple et élégant mais une chose me dérange. Il est possible d'obtenir une request.exception.ConnectionError avec un message comme: Max retries exceeded with url: ... Cela implique que les demandes peuvent tenter d'accéder aux données plusieurs fois. Mais il n'y a aucune mention de cette …




En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.